Energy from The SunSolar Thermal (Heat) EnergySolar Photovoltaic SystemsBenefits and LimitationsSolar photovoltaic (PV) devices, or solar cells, convert sunlight directly into electricity. Small PV cells can power calculators, watches, and other small electronic devices. Larger solar cells are grouped in PV panels, and PV panels are connnected in arrays that can produce electricity for an entire house.
